Factors Affecting Cost
- Vineyard Size: Larger vineyards require more labor and time to prune, increasing overall costs.
- Type of Grapevine: Different grape varieties may need specific pruning techniques, impacting labor costs.
- Labor Rates: Local labor rates can vary, affecting the total cost of pruning services.
- Pruning Season: The time of year can influence costs due to demand and availability of labor.
- Equipment Used: The need for specialized pruning equipment can add to the overall expense.
- Vineyard Accessibility: Easy-to-access vineyards may incur lower costs compared to those in challenging terrains.
- Experience of Workers: More experienced workers might charge higher rates but can be more efficient.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Simi Valley, CA) |
---|---|
Pruning per acre | $200 - $500 |
Specialized pruning | $250 - $600 |
Labor cost per hour | $20 - $35 |
Equipment rental per day | $50 - $100 |
Disposal of pruned vines | $100 - $200 |
